Output 52a03deb818db5c902d404db606b4eac1e6e4613808db96f99f3011855b3867a:1

value
697700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2b2bb14853d96bc231ba0976c26e58762fbe0bb OP_EQUAL
address
3HytK82fnqMsRLqwBQYhgEPoWa6JFeiHws
transaction
52a03deb818db5c902d404db606b4eac1e6e4613808db96f99f3011855b3867a
spent
true